#2Definitions of Revolution

1 Overthrow & replacement of an established government or political system by the

people governed

2 Radical & pervasive change in society & social structure, made suddenly, often

accompanied by violence

Date Important Event

~1540 Approximate date for the Scientific Revolution

~1680 Approximate date of the Age of Enlightenment

1763 The Seven Years’ War & Salutary Neglect end

1775 The American Revolution begins

1776 Two important documents are published: • Paine’s Common Sense• Jefferson’s Declaration of Independence

~1780 The Age of Enlightenment ends

1787 The Constitution of the United States written

1789 The French Revolution begins
